1. Tuckaway Shores Resort (3-star hotel)

About this hotel

Set on the beach, this casual, oceanfront hotel is 6.5 miles from Andretti Thrill Park (with go-kart tracks and mini-golf courses) and 21.7 miles from Cape Canaveral.The unpretentious suites sleep up to 5 people, and offer balconies or patios with full or partial ocean views. They include free Wi-Fi, kitchenettes and cable TV.Parking is free, and beach towels and toys are provided. There’s a courtyard with an outdoor heated pool and deck chairs, plus a fish-cleaning station, a charcoal BBQ and a business center.

4. Port d’Hiver Bed and Breakfast (4-star hotel)

About this hotel

Set in a 1916 house with annexes and surrounded by palm trees, this elegant B&B lies across the street from the beach along the Atlantic Ocean. It’s 2 miles from both Spessard Holland Golf Course and Route 192.Genteel, airy rooms and suites with antique furnishings and en suite bathrooms have balconies or porches with courtyard, pool or ocean views, and whirlpool tubs. Some come with vaulted ceilings, 4-poster beds and/or sofabeds.Cooked-to-order breakfast is served in-room or in a dining room. Parking, and evening wine and snacks are free. There’s a courtyard with a fire pit, an outdoor pool and a hot tub. Kids age 10 and older are welcome.

13. Windemere Inn by the Sea (3-star hotel)

About this hotel

This oceanfront boutique bed-and-breakfast is housed in 3 separate buildings off Route 192, 3.4 miles from downtown Melbourne.The classic, individually decorated rooms all have en suite bathrooms, some with Jacuzzis or spa showers, flat-screen TVs and free Wi-Fi. Some have private balconies with beach views.Cooked breakfast is included and there are also 2 self-service pantries equipped with microwaves and coffeemakers and stocked with complimentary snacks and sodas. The hotel has a private beach with a gazebo (and will deliver lunch to guests there), and has an on-site licensed massage therapist (surcharge).
